    3. Tobar na mBaraillidhe - Well of the Barrels
    4. Cnoc na Scolb - Hill of the Scallops
    5. Ballyboy - Ballabuidhe - Yellow Wall
    6. Bóthairín na Móna Ruaidhe - Little Road of the Red Boy
    7. Cummeen - The Commonage
    8. Coummahon - Com Machan - Mahon Hollow
    9. Furraleigh - An Foradh Liach - The Grey Wattles Bridge
    10. Graiguerush - Gruaig a Rúis - Village of the Shrubbery
    11. kealfune - Caol Fionn - White Narrow Place
    12. Bóthairín na gCorp - Little Road of the Corpses
    13. Killnagrange - Cill na Gráinsighe - Church of the Grange. The site of an early church was discovered near the eastern extremity of the townland, in east side of the Kilmacthomas - Clonea Road. Mark of the circular fence of cill, enclosing about an ace and a half, is still traceable
